Founded in 1989, Greenfield Global is one of the world’s leading suppliers of high-purity alcohols, specialty solvents, custom solutions, and fuel ethanol for businesses across the globe. Serving diverse markets—including renewable fuels, beverages, life sciences, food, and industrial products—Greenfield operates 4 distilleries, 5 blending facilities, and 9 warehouses, efficiently fulfilling over 35,000 orders in more than 50 countries. The company runs a major anaerobic digestion facility that converts 120,000 tonnes of organic material annually into renewable natural gas. Greenfield’s low-carbon ethanol supports decarbonization efforts, and its team is innovating in sustainable fuels such as green hydrogen, methanol, aviation fuel, and renewable natural gas. Headquartered in Toronto, this family-owned business has consistently earned Platinum status among Canada’s Best Managed Companies since 2015.
